Virtua Fighter Esports is rumored to be Sega's next attempt at relaunching the series. They launched a trailer for it some time last year, but provided no context to what it is exactly. Speculation is ranging to everything from being a remaster of the last game with better stat tracking for an Esports focus, to an update in the Capcom vein (i.e. champion edition/super...etc) to an entirely new project altogether. Whatever it is...Sega has been playing it very low key and has been keeping it's secrets very close to their chests.

^Virtua Fighter and Dead or Alive aren't as different as you might believe. Tecmo (Team Ninja) built their engine on Model 2 Sega tech to make the first DOA. In fact, Tecmo used Virtua Fighter's graphics-engine as the foundation of DOA and this fact likely had much to do with why the port for the Sega Saturn was superior (marginally) on the console in comparison to the Playstation version despite the Sony machine being built to support the advent of polygonal graphics.
The games are spiritual cousins and it was for this reason that Tecmo included Virtua characters in DOA 5. As far as Storm's plans are concerned, I wouldn't be surprised to see DOA fighters licensed by the manufacturer. |
